The TCS230 is a color sensor used to detect and measure the color of an object. It features an array of photodiodes with red, green, and blue filters, along with a built-in RGB color sensing element. The sensor is widely used in various applications, including color recognition, sorting systems, and educational projects. Key Features:
  • Integrated RGB color sensing
  • High resolution with 8x8 photodiode array
  • Adjustable light sensitivity
  • Provides digital output (frequency) proportional to the color intensity
  • Simple interfacing with microcontrollers
  • Compact size and low power consumption
Technical Specifications:
  • Photodiode Array: 8x8 pixels (64 total)
  • Output: Digital frequency output (proportional to color intensity)
  • Operating Voltage: 2.7V to 5.5V DC
  • Current Consumption: Approximately 10mA
  • Light Sensitivity: Adjustable via external resistors
  • Temperature Range: -40°C to +85°C
  • Dimensions: 13.8 mm x 13.8 mm
  • Package: 8-pin LCC (Leadless Chip Carrier)
Applications:
  • Color Recognition: Detect and identify colors in various applications
  • Sorting Systems: Sort objects based on color for automation processes
  • Educational Projects: Teach principles of color sensing and electronics
  • Robotics: Use in robots for color-based tasks and navigation
  • Quality Control: Check color consistency in manufacturing processes
Usage:
  1. Connect the TCS230 sensor to a microcontroller or development board according to the pinout configuration.
  2. Configure the sensor’s light sensitivity using external resistors if needed.
  3. Read the frequency output corresponding to the intensity of each color (red, green, blue) using the microcontroller.
  4. Process the color data for your application, such as color detection or sorting.
Caution:
  • Ensure the sensor is connected correctly to avoid damage.
  • Avoid exposing the sensor to direct sunlight or intense light sources to prevent saturation and inaccurate readings.
  • Handle with care to avoid damage to the delicate photodiode array.
